Output 870afbee3ecf301dadaeb5d3a2c6b63b8161a8673ec2f09053945a074de19a35:41

value
74193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25ae8f9467411a8e1755bf9ca487d8221f38c30d OP_EQUAL
address
358G3LpYuGhwRcJDpfCMiFmSqTC27a3r4N
transaction
870afbee3ecf301dadaeb5d3a2c6b63b8161a8673ec2f09053945a074de19a35
spent
true